ODFL trades at a discount to the industrials sector on P/E despite superior margins and lower leverage, suggesting relative value, though absolute multiples remain elevated for a company with negative growth
- P/E of 26.62 below sector average of 31.89 despite higher profitability
- Forward P/E of 22.42 suggests pricing in of earnings recovery
- High absolute valuation: P/E 26.6x and Price/Sales 5.08x leave little margin for error
- Lack of EV/EBITDA and ROIC data limits full capital efficiency assessment
Near-term growth metrics are negative and price momentum remains weak across 1Y to 1W horizons, though forward multiples and analyst targets suggest anticipation of a cyclical rebound in freight demand
- Analyst target price of $156.95 implies 18.6% upside, signaling confidence in recovery
- Forward P/E of 22.42 reflects expectation of earnings rebound
- Revenue growth of -4.3% YoY and Q/Q earnings decline of -12.2% point to ongoing softness
- No visible inflection in price trends: 50-day and 200-day moving averages unavailable but 1Y return of -40.4% shows deep underperformance
ODFL has demonstrated exceptional earnings execution over the past six years with consistent beats and margin expansion, but recent quarters show weakening trends amid a sharp 40.4% share price decline over the past year
- Long-term earnings consistency: 21 of last 25 quarters beat or met estimates
- High average earnings surprise of +5.9% over last 4 quarters and +6.2% over last 10
- Recent earnings misses: 2 of last 4 quarters missed or barely met expectations
- 1-year share price return of -40.4% underperforms both sector and broader market
ODFL’s financial health is best-in-class with negligible leverage and solid liquidity, significantly outperforming peers like NSC (1.16 D/E) and CARR (0.83 D/E), providing a strong buffer during economic downturns
- Near-zero leverage with Debt/Equity of 0.02, among the lowest in the sector
- Strong liquidity: Current ratio of 1.20 and quick ratio of 1.06 indicate solid short-term financial stability
- Missing total cash and debt figures limit full liquidity runway assessment
- No free cash flow or operating cash flow data available for trend analysis
ODFL maintains a conservative and sustainable dividend policy with a low payout ratio, though the 0.85% yield offers limited appeal in a sector where income generation is often a key consideration
- Low payout ratio of 22.13% ensures high sustainability and room for future increases
- Dividend yield of 0.85% provides modest income with strong coverage
- Yield is below peer average and may not attract income-focused investors
- Lack of 5-year yield history limits assessment of dividend growth policy
